Output 250e7017c14ff50039cd4ae78c46a8ab623c65cdaa56d3b042748c0dc17d0155:0

value
1512646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140c9c87ba9bec579e4e7477ddc562e21ab45d14 OP_EQUAL
address
33X2Ye1qVa7mRL6Fwnva7sPNhUez9ecQuq
transaction
250e7017c14ff50039cd4ae78c46a8ab623c65cdaa56d3b042748c0dc17d0155
spent
true